body
{
background: none;
background-color: #000000;
margin: 0 auto;
text-align: center;
}

#CampingBody
{
background: #000000 url() no-repeat scroll top center;
margin: 0 auto;
text-align: center;
}

img
{
display: block;
}

form
{
display: inline;
}

#PageWrapper
{
position: relative;
width: 979px;
margin: 0 auto;
text-align: center;
background: transparent url() repeat-y scroll 1px 0;
}

.ey-right-fill
{
position: absolute;
right: 0px;
*right: -1px;
top: 196px;
z-index: 10000;
}

.ey-bottom-right-fill
{
position: absolute;
right: -7px;
*right: -8px;
bottom: 39px;
z-index: 10000;
}

#Header
{
width: 979px;
position: relative;
}

#Header img
{
display: block !important;
}

.searchInput
{
position: absolute;
top: 123px;
left: 351px;
width: 230px;
height: 18px;
border: 0;
}

.searchSubmit
{
position: absolute;
top: 122px;
left: 585px;
}

#LeftColumn
{
float: left;
width: 211px;
text-align: left;
}

#RightColumn
{
float: left;
width: 729px;
margin: 0px 25px 0px 14px;
text-align: left;
}

#Footer
{
clear: both;
width: 979px;
height: 39px;
position: relative;
background: #652215 url() no-repeat;
text-align: left;
}

.catNav
{
background-color: #e6e6e1;
font: bold 12px arial;
color: black;
border-right: 1px solid #44563c;
width: 210px;
}

.catNav ul
{
margin: 0;
padding: 0;
width: 205px;
margin-left: 5px;
list-style: none;
}

.catNav ul li
{
background: transparent url() no-repeat scroll left center;
background-position-x: -1px;
font: bold 12px arial;
color: #000000;
border-top: 1px solid #c4c4c4;
padding-top: 2px;
padding-bottom: 2px;
padding-right: 6px;
}

.catNav ul li.selected
{
background: transparent url() no-repeat scroll left center;
font: bold 12px arial;
color: #000000;
border-top: 1px solid #c4c4c4;
padding-top: 2px;
padding-bottom: 2px;
padding-right: 6px;
}

.catNav ul li div
{
padding-left: 16px;
}

.catNav ul li div a:link
{
font: bold 12px arial;
color: #000000;
text-decoration: none;
}

.catNav ul li div a:visited
{
font: bold 12px arial;
color: #000000;
text-decoration: none;
}

.catNav ul li div a:hover
{
font: bold 12px arial;
color: #000000;
text-decoration: underline;
}

.catNav ul li div a:active
{
font: bold 12px arial;
color: #000000;
text-decoration: none;
}

.catNav ul li.selected div a:link
{
font: bold 12px arial;
color: #94361c;
text-decoration: none;
}

.catNav ul li.selected div a:visited
{
font: bold 12px arial;
color: #94361c;
text-decoration: none;
}

.catNav ul li.selected div a:hover
{
font: bold 12px arial;
color: #94361c;
text-decoration: underline;
}

.catNav ul li.selected div a:active
{
font: bold 12px arial;
color: #94361c;
text-decoration: none;
}

.ey-newsletter
{
width: 210px;
height: 170px;
background: transparent url() no-repeat;
position: relative;
}

.ey-leftnav-bottom
{
background: transparent url() no-repeat;
width: 210px;
height: 278px;
text-align: center;
}

.eyText
{
font: normal 11px arial;
color: black;
}

.eyText2
{
font: normal 12px arial;
color: black;
}

.eyFeaturedSection
{
width: 729px;
height: 24px;
background: transparent url() no-repeat;
}

.eyFeaturedTitle
{
padding-left: 14px;
width: 212px;
font: bold 12px arial;
color: #f8e4b5;
vertical-align: middle;
}

.eyFeaturedTitle2
{
padding-left: 14px;
width: 212px;
font: bold 14px arial;
color: #ffffff;
vertical-align: middle;
}

.eyFeaturedLink
{
padding-right: 10px;
width: 517px;
font: normal 11px arial;
color: white;
vertical-align: middle;
text-align: right;
}

.eyFeaturedLink a:link
{
text-decoration: none;
font: normal 11px arial;
color: white;
}

.eyFeaturedLink a:visited
{
text-decoration: none;
font: normal 11px arial;
color: white;
}

.eyFeaturedLink a:hover
{
text-decoration: underline;
font: normal 11px arial;
color: white;
}

.eyFeaturedLink a:active
{
text-decoration: none;
font: normal 11px arial;
color: white;
}

.contentsName
{
font: bold 12px arial;
color: black;
}

.contentsName a:link
{
font: bold 12px arial;
color: black;
text-decoration: none;
}

.contentsName a:visited
{
font: bold 12px arial;
color: black;
text-decoration: none;
}

.contentsName a:hover
{
font: bold 12px arial;
color: black;
text-decoration: underline;
}

.contentsName a:active
{
font: bold 12px arial;
color: black;
text-decoration: none;
}

.contentsRegPrice
{
font: normal 11px arial;
color: #808080;
}

.contentsSalePrice
{
font: bold 12px arial;
color: black;
}

.footerLinks
{
font: normal 11px arial;
color: white;
}

.footerLinks a:link
{
font: normal 11px arial;
color: white;
text-decoration: none;
}

.footerLinks a:visited
{
font: normal 11px arial;
color: white;
text-decoration: none;
}

.footerLinks a:hover
{
font: normal 11px arial;
color: white;
text-decoration: underline;
}

.footerLinks a:active
{
font: normal 11px arial;
color: white;
text-decoration: none;
}

td.footerLinks div.eyCopyright
{
font-size: 10px;
}

td.footerLinks div.eyCopyright a:link
{
font-size: 10px;
text-decoration: underline;
}

td.footerLinks div.eyCopyright a:visited
{
font-size: 10px;
text-decoration: underline;
}

td.footerLinks div.eyCopyright a:hover
{
font-size: 10px;
text-decoration: underline;
}

td.footerLinks div.eyCopyright a:active
{
font-size: 10px;
text-decoration: underline;
}

.breadcrumbs
{
color: #000000;
font: normal 0px arial;
margin-bottom: 0px;
}

.breadcrumbs a:link
{
color: #808080;
font: normal 10px arial;
text-decoration: none;
}

.breadcrumbs a:visited
{
color: #808080;
font: normal 10px arial;
text-decoration: none;
}

.breadcrumbs a:hover
{
color: #808080;
font: normal 10px arial;
text-decoration: underline;
}

.breadcrumbs a:active
{
color: #808080;
font: normal 10px arial;
text-decoration: none;
}

.itemName
{
font: bold 16px arial;
color: #366e86;
padding-bottom: 1px;
border-bottom: 1px solid #366e86;
width: 100%;
}

.eyPriceWrapper
{
position: relative;
height: 58px;
width: 98px;
font: bold 12px arial;
color: black;
}

.eyPriceWrapper table tr td
{
font: bold 12px arial;
color: black;
}

.eyPricePiece
{
position: absolute;
right: -22px;
bottom: -1px;
}

.eyPrice
{
font: bold 20px arial;
color: #92361b;
}

.sectionTitle
{
font: bold 22px tahoma;
color: #fdfad1;
padding-top: 15px;
padding-left: 10px;
}

h1.sectionTitleH1
{
font: bold 22px tahoma;
color: #fdfad1;
margin: 0;
padding: 0;
}

.featuredItemTableMain
{
position: relative;
width: 493px;
height: 264px;
background: transparent url() no-repeat;
}

.featuredItemTableMainImage
{
position: absolute;
left: 111px;
top: 44px;
width: 270px;
height: 134px;
text-align: center;
}

.featuredItemTableMainTitle
{
position: absolute;
left: 28px;
top: 198px;
color: #ecb87a;
font: bold 14px arial;
}

.featuredItemTableMainTitle a:link
{
color: #ecb87a;
font: bold 14px arial;
text-decoration: none;
}

.featuredItemTableMainTitle a:visited
{
color: #ecb87a;
font: bold 14px arial;
text-decoration: none;
}

.featuredItemTableMainTitle a:hover
{
color: #ecb87a;
font: bold 14px arial;
text-decoration: underline;
}

.featuredItemTableMainTitle a:active
{
color: #ecb87a;
font: bold 14px arial;
text-decoration: none;
}

.featuredItemTableMainPrice
{
position: absolute;
right: 26px;
top: 198px;
color: #ecb87a;
font: normal 14px arial;
}

.featuredItemTableMainDesc
{
font: normal 11px arial;
color: white;
position: absolute;
left: 28px;
top: 221px;
width: 350px;
height: 28px;
}

.featuredItemTableMainButton
{
position: absolute;
left: 389px;
top: 228px;
}

.featuredItemTableKicker1
{
position: relative;
width: 234px;
height: 89px;
background: transparent url() no-repeat;
}

.featuredItemTableKicker1Image
{
position: absolute;
left: 8px;
top: 16px;
width: 77px;
height: 57px;
text-align: center;
}

.featuredItemTableKicker1Title
{
position: absolute;
left: 82px;
top: 16px;
color: #384631;
font: bold 14px arial;
}

.featuredItemTableKicker1Title a:link
{
color: #384631;
font: bold 14px arial;
text-decoration: none;
}

.featuredItemTableKicker1Title a:visited
{
color: #384631;
font: bold 14px arial;
text-decoration: none;
}

.featuredItemTableKicker1Title a:hover
{
color: #384631;
font: bold 14px arial;
text-decoration: underline;
}

.featuredItemTableKicker1Title a:active
{
color: #384631;
font: bold 14px arial;
text-decoration: none;
}

.featuredItemTableKicker1Desc
{
font: normal 11px arial;
color: black;
position: absolute;
left: 82px;
top: 34px;
width: 125px;
height: 28px;
}

.featuredItemTableKicker1Button
{
position: absolute;
left: 154px;
top: 67px;
}

.featuredItemTableKicker2
{
position: relative;
width: 234px;
height: 86px;
background: transparent url() no-repeat;
}

.featuredItemTableKicker2Image
{
position: absolute;
right: 8px;
top: 16px;
width: 77px;
height: 57px;
text-align: center;
}

.featuredItemTableKicker2Title
{
position: absolute;
left: 7px;
top: 9px;
color: #384631;
font: bold 14px arial;
}

.featuredItemTableKicker2Title a:link
{
color: #384631;
font: bold 14px arial;
text-decoration: none;
}

.featuredItemTableKicker2Title a:visited
{
color: #384631;
font: bold 14px arial;
text-decoration: none;
}

.featuredItemTableKicker2Title a:hover
{
color: #384631;
font: bold 14px arial;
text-decoration: underline;
}

.featuredItemTableKicker2Title a:active
{
color: #384631;
font: bold 14px arial;
text-decoration: none;
}

.featuredItemTableKicker2Desc
{
font: normal 11px arial;
color: black;
position: absolute;
left: 7px;
top: 27px;
width: 125px;
height: 28px;
}

.featuredItemTableKicker2Button
{
position: absolute;
left: 3px;
top: 62px;
}

.featuredItemTableKicker3
{
position: relative;
width: 234px;
height: 89px;
background: transparent url() no-repeat;
}

.featuredItemTableKicker3Image
{
position: absolute;
left: 8px;
top: 16px;
width: 77px;
height: 57px;
text-align: center;
}

.featuredItemTableKicker3Title
{
position: absolute;
left: 82px;
top: 14px;
color: #384631;
font: bold 14px arial;
}

.featuredItemTableKicker3Title a:link
{
color: #384631;
font: bold 14px arial;
text-decoration: none;
}

.featuredItemTableKicker3Title a:visited
{
color: #384631;
font: bold 14px arial;
text-decoration: none;
}

.featuredItemTableKicker3Title a:hover
{
color: #384631;
font: bold 14px arial;
text-decoration: underline;
}

.featuredItemTableKicker3Title a:active
{
color: #384631;
font: bold 14px arial;
text-decoration: none;
}

.featuredItemTableKicker3Desc
{
font: normal 11px arial;
color: black;
position: absolute;
left: 82px;
top: 32px;
width: 125px;
height: 28px;
}

.featuredItemTableKicker3Button
{
position: absolute;
left: 152px;
top: 65px;
}

.articleTitle
{
color: #3a0000;
font: bold 18px arial;
margin-bottom: 5px;
}

h1.articleTitleH1
{
font: bold 22px tahoma;
color: #370000;
margin: 0;
padding: 0;
}

.articleAuthor
{
color: #3a0000;
font: bold 12px arial;
}

.newsInput
{
position: absolute;
top: 98px;
left: 35px;
width: 145px;
height: 18px;
border: 0;
font: normal 11px arial;
}

.newsSubmit
{
position: absolute;
top: 119px;
left: 129px;
}

#myTabs
{ 
width: 700px; 
text-align: left; 
position: relative;
}

#myTabs #AllTs
{
}

#myTabs #AllTs a:link, #myTabs #AllTs a:visited
{
text-decoration: none;  
}

#myTabs #AllTs .selected1
{  
}

#myTabs.t1 #t2 { display: none; }
#myTabs.t1 #c2 { display: none; }

#myTabs.t2 #t1 { display: none }
#myTabs.t2 #c1 { display: none }

#Tab1
{
font: normal 12px arial;
}

#Tab2
{
font: normal 12px arial;
}

.reviewTable
{
font: normal 12px arial;
}

#Tab1 ul
{
list-style: inside;
}
